  • 摘要:This paper deals with the structure, activity, and liquidation of the Danube-Sava Vicinal Railway Stock Company during the Kingdom of Serbs, Croats, and Slovenes/Yugoslavia. The company, founded in 1912, was based in Budapest and constructed the following railway lines: Vukovar-Ilača and Šid-Sremska Rača-Sava. These private railway lines were exploited by the state. The stock company was solvent. After the collapse of the Austro-Hungarian Empire, the company’s headquarters moved from Budapest to Zagreb. Shortly after the establishment of the Kingdom of Serbs, Croats, and Slovens/Yugoslavia, the railway lines were exploited by the Directorate of State Railways in Zagreb, but after 1921 they came under the jurisdiction of the Directorate of State Railways in Belgrade. According to the Agreement of February 7, 1931, the state redeemed the railway lines of the abovementioned company and thus the company ceased to exist. The company went into liquidation in 1932 and was shut down on April 12, 1933.
